Semantic discovery and reuse of business process patterns
Patterns currently play an important role in modern information systems (IS) development and their use has mainly been restricted to the design and implementation phases of the development lifecycle. Given the increasing significance of business modelling in IS development, patterns have the potential of providing a viable solution for promoting reusability of recurrent generalized models in the very early stages of development. As a statement of research-in-progress this paper focuses on business process patterns and proposes an initial methodological framework for the discovery and reuse of business process patterns within the IS development lifecycle. The framework borrows ideas from the domain engineering literature and proposes the use of semantics to drive both the discovery of patterns as well as their reuse

EU-China collaboration in design: research in Web-enabled collaborative design supported by the Asia-Link and Asia IT&C projects
The research of Web-enabled collaboration in total design supported by the European Union's Asia Link project [1] and Asia IT&C project is reported in this paper. The two projects both aim at enhancing research collaboration between the EU and China. The Virtual Research Institute (VRI) is described first, which is the platform for the collaboration for the Asia Link project and is established by utilizing the advanced Web techniques; and then, the framework for the collaboration and the Web techniques involved in the research are presented which represent the major research of the Asia IT&C project. The effective collaboration between the project partners and the impacts of the project outcome on the partnership are also discussed

Intranet of the future: functional study, comparison of products and practical implementation
Future intranet: functional study, comparison of products and practical implementation 1. Introduction The project has fulfilled three goals: 1) To perform a study of the functionalities which have to be covered in a modern intranet (web 2.0, unified communication, collaboration, etc) 2) To perform a comparison of tools of the market which can be used to implement intranets (commercial and open source products) 3) To test three of these tools (Oracle WebCenter, Liferay Portal and Microsoft SharePoint) and develop a prototype with Oracle WebCenter. In addition, it includes a research about the evolution of the Intranets among the time, as well as a work to discover the current state of this kind of platforms over the entire world. In this introductory research it is also convenient to include other topics which are not strictly technical involving the use of this Intranet. To be more concrete, there is an analysis of the importance of the human role and management of the Intranet, the process of deploying a new Intranet in an organization and methods to evaluate the performance of this new system. 2. Functional study The approach taken to fulfil this goal is to develop a theoretical model describing the relationship between the Intranet and its users, and a complete set of functionalities which could be covered in the Intranet of the future. These functionalities are categorized in groups. The project describes these groups and the functionalities included on them. 3. Comparison of products The project will describe and compare several technologies which can be used to develop an Intranet that we have previously modelled. The purpose here is to discover the strong points and weaknesses of each technology if it was used to develop the Intranet we desire. After having done such a review, the project focuses on three technologies and performs an extensive evaluation of them. Finally, an extensive comparison between these three technologies is done, highlighting where they offer better solutions and performance compared to the other possibilities. 4. Practical implementation The project focuses on three technologies: Oracle WebCenter, Liferay Portal and Microsoft SharePoint. Then, a prototype which covers a set of functionalities of the modelled Intranet has been built with Oracle WebCenter
